Запитання з тегом «coding-style»

**НЕ ВИКОРИСТОВУВАТИ! Цей тег посилається на суперечливу тему і тому більше не є темою. ** Питання, що відповідають стилю та умовам кодування.

8
Як розірвати лінію ланцюгових методів у Python?
У мене є рядок із наступного коду (не звинувачуйте в назві конвенцій, вони не мої): subkeyword = Session.query( Subkeyword.subkeyword_id, Subkeyword.subkeyword_word ).filter_by( subkeyword_company_id=self.e_company_id ).filter_by( subkeyword_word=subkeyword_word ).filter_by( subkeyword_active=True ).one() Мені не подобається, як це виглядає (не надто читабельно), але я не маю кращої ідеї обмежувати рядки до 79 символів у цій ситуації. …

10
Чи повинен <STYLE> бути в <HEAD> HTML-документі?
Власне кажучи, чи styleповинні теги знаходитися всередині headдокумента HTML? Стандарт 4.01 передбачає це, але прямо не вказано: Елемент STYLE дозволяє авторам розміщувати правила таблиці стилів у голові документа. HTML дозволяє будь-яку кількість елементів STYLE в розділі HEAD документа. Я кажу "строго кажучи", тому що у мене є додаток, який розміщує …


7
Посібник зі стилю кодування для додатків node.js? [зачинено]
Зачинено. Це питання не відповідає вказівкам щодо переповнення стека . Наразі відповіді не приймаються. Хочете вдосконалити це питання? Оновіть питання, щоб воно було тематичним для переповнення стека. Закрито 3 роки тому . Удосконаліть це питання Чи існує (або кілька) посібник зі стилю кодування для node.js? Якщо ні, то які нові …

24
Коли функція занадто довга? [зачинено]
Наразі це запитання не підходить для нашого формату запитань. Ми очікуємо, що відповіді будуть підкріплені фактами, посиланнями або експертними знаннями, але це питання, ймовірно, вимагатиме дискусій, аргументів, опитувань чи розширеної дискусії. Якщо ви вважаєте, що це питання можна вдосконалити та, можливо, знову відкрити, відвідайте довідковий центр для ознайомлення . Закрито …

15
Чи погана практика використовувати if-оператор без фігурних дужок? [зачинено]
Закрито . Це питання ґрунтується на думці . Наразі відповіді не приймаються. Хочете вдосконалити це питання? Оновіть питання, щоб на нього можна було відповісти фактами та цитатами, редагуючи цю публікацію . Закрито 5 років тому . Удосконаліть це питання Я бачив такий код: if(statement) do this; else do this; Однак …

7
Склад функцій Haskell (.) Та функціональних застосувань ($): правильне використання
Я читав Haskell в реальному світі , і я наближаюся до кінця, але питання стилю насміхувало, що стосується операторів (.)та ($)операторів. Коли ви пишете функцію, що є складом інших функцій, ви записуєте її так: f = g . h Але коли ви застосовуєте щось до кінця цих функцій, я записую …

17
Чи є вагомі причини використовувати верхній регістр для ключових слів SQL? [зачинено]
Закрито . Це питання ґрунтується на думці . Наразі відповіді не приймаються. Хочете вдосконалити це питання? Оновіть питання, щоб на нього можна було відповісти фактами та цитатами, редагуючи цю публікацію . Закрито 4 роки тому . Удосконаліть це питання За замовчуванням, мабуть, це великі регістри, але чи дійсно є підстави …

10
Який найелегантніший спосіб привласнити номер до сегмента?
Скажімо x, aі bце числа. Мені потрібно обмежувати xмежі сегмента [a, b]. Я можу писати Math.max(a, Math.min(x, b)), але я не думаю, що це дуже легко читати. Хтось має розумний спосіб написати це більш читабельним способом?

2
Відступ у програмі Go: вкладки чи пробіли?
Чи є десь стандартний документ із умовами кодування Google Go, який встановлює, чи вкладки чи пробіли є кращими для відступу у вихідному коді Go? Якщо ні, то який (статистично) більш популярний варіант? Яка офіційна рекомендація? (якщо якийсь) Який більш популярний вибір?

26
Чи булеві як аргументи методу неприйнятні? [зачинено]
Закрито . Це питання ґрунтується на думці . Наразі відповіді не приймаються. Хочете вдосконалити це питання? Оновіть питання, щоб на нього можна було відповісти фактами та цитатами, відредагувавши цю публікацію . Закрито 2 роки тому . Удосконаліть це питання Мій колега заявляє, що булеви як аргументи методу неприйнятні . Їх …

12
Переключити перехід заяви на випадок ... чи слід це дозволити? [зачинено]
Наразі це запитання не підходить для нашого формату запитань. Ми очікуємо, що відповіді будуть підкріплені фактами, посиланнями або експертними знаннями, але це питання, ймовірно, вимагатиме дискусій, аргументів, опитувань чи розширеної дискусії. Якщо ви вважаєте, що це питання можна вдосконалити та, можливо, знову відкрити, відвідайте довідковий центр для ознайомлення . Закрито …

6
Коли в Python, коли я повинен використовувати функцію замість методу?
Дзен Python заявляє, що робити лише один спосіб - але часто я стикаюся з проблемою вирішення питання про те, коли використовувати функцію, а не коли використовувати метод. Візьмемо тривіальний приклад - об’єкт ChessBoard. Скажімо, нам потрібен певний спосіб отримати всі законні кроки короля, доступні на дошці. Чи пишемо ми ChessBoard.get_king_moves …

8
Стандарти / найкращі практики кодування Python [закрито]
Наразі це запитання не підходить для нашого формату запитань. Ми очікуємо, що відповіді будуть підкріплені фактами, посиланнями або експертними знаннями, але це питання, ймовірно, вимагатиме дискусій, аргументів, опитувань чи розширеної дискусії. Якщо ви вважаєте, що це питання можна вдосконалити та, можливо, знову відкрити, відвідайте довідковий центр для ознайомлення . Закрито …

8
Названня атрибутів HTML "class" та "id" - тире та підкреслення [закрито]
Закрито . Це питання ґрунтується на думці . Наразі відповіді не приймаються. Хочете вдосконалити це питання? Оновіть питання, щоб на нього можна було відповісти фактами та цитатами, відредагувавши цю публікацію . Закрито 5 років тому . Удосконаліть це питання &lt;div id="example-value"&gt;або &lt;div id="example_value"&gt;? Цей сайт і Twitter використовують перший стиль. …

Використовуючи наш веб-сайт, ви визнаєте, що прочитали та зрозуміли наші Політику щодо файлів cookie та Політику конфіденційності.
Licensed under cc by-sa 3.0 with attribution required.